The Tongyeong–Daejeon Expressway (Korean: 통영대전고속도로) is an expressway in South Korea. It connects Tongyeong to Daejeon. The expressway's route number is 35, which it shares with the Jungbu Expressway. This expressway joins the Gyeongbu Expressway at Cheongju and they divide again at Daejeon.

History

  • March 1992 - Construction begins as Daejeon–Tongyeong Expressway
  • 20 December 1996 - Jinju-West Jinju segment opens to traffic.
  • 22 October 1998 - West Jinju-Hamyang segment opens to traffic.
  • 6 September 1999 - Sannae-Biryong segment opens to traffic.
  • 22 December 2000 - Muju-Sannae segment opens to traffic.
  • August 2001 - Numbered 35, which it shares with the Jungbu Expressway.
  • 29 November 2001 - Hamyang-Muju segment opens to traffic.
  • December 2002 - Renamed to Tongyeong–Daejeon Expressway
  • 14 December 2005 - Tongyeong-Jinju segment opens to traffic.
